Examining Waste Types

Various projects produce various types of waste, and each type may require different handling:

General Waste: This includes daily household items and is normally straightforward to deal with. A lot of basic dumpsters appropriate for this kind of waste.

Construction Debris: For materials like wood, drywall, and metal, you'll require a dumpster created to handle heavier loads. Some dumpsters are specifically developed to accommodate building and construction waste.

Hazardous Materials: Items such as chemicals or asbestos need special handling and can not be gotten rid of in routine dumpsters. You will require to schedule specialized garbage disposal services.

Understanding the type of waste will help you select a dumpster that is equipped to handle your requirements and adhere to local guidelines.

Comprehending Costs and Rental Terms

Dumpster rental costs are influenced by numerous aspects:

Size and Weight Limits: Different dumpsters have varying capacities and weight limitations. Ensure you choose a dumpster that can manage your job's load without exceeding these limitations.

Rental Duration: Dumpster leasings are typically based on a set duration. Be clear about for how long you will require the dumpster to prevent service charges.

Extra Fees: Ask about possible extra expenses, such as those for overloading the dumpster, keeping it longer than concurred, or inappropriate waste disposal.

Being aware of these elements can help you handle your budget successfully and avoid unanticipated costs.

Planning for Placement and Access

Appropriate positioning of your dumpster is important for effective usage:

Location: Choose an area that is accessible for both the dumpster shipment and pickup. It ought to not block driveways or sidewalks.

Surface: A flat, difficult surface area is perfect for placing a dumpster. Avoid positioning it on soft ground, as the weight of the dumpster could cause damage.

Safety: Ensure the location around the dumpster is clear of barriers and safe for both the delivery truck and users.

Efficient Use of the Dumpster

As soon as you have your dumpster, utilize it effectively to maximize its capacity:

Disperse Weight Evenly: Spread out the waste to prevent overloading any side of the dumpster, which could cause instability.

Avoid Overfilling: Keep waste below the leading edge of the dumpster to prevent spillage and added fees.

Recycle When Possible: Separate recyclables from general waste to decrease the volume of waste and support environment-friendly disposal practices.
